Jih-Jie Chang has authored 6 papers that have received a total of 2.9k indexed citations.
This includes 2 papers in Artificial Intelligence, 2 papers in Experimental and Cognitive Psychology and 1 paper in Cognitive Neuroscience. The topics of these papers are Visual and Cognitive Learning Processes (2 papers), Memory Processes and Influences (1 paper) and Cognitive and developmental aspects of mathematical skills (1 paper). Jih-Jie Chang is often cited by papers focused on Visual and Cognitive Learning Processes (2 papers), Memory Processes and Influences (1 paper) and Cognitive and developmental aspects of mathematical skills (1 paper) and collaborates with scholars based in United States. Jih-Jie Chang's co-authors include Roger N. Shepard, Christopher W. Tyler, J. Douglas Carroll and Béla Julesz and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the Optical Society of America A and Psychometrika
